FAQs
What on earth is Carbon Capture and Storage (CCS)?
Carbon Capture and Storage (CCS) is a technologies designed to lessen CO₂ emissions from industrial processes and ability technology. It really works by capturing carbon dioxide within the supply, transporting it, and after that storing it deep underground in geological formations to forestall it from entering the environment.
So how exactly does CCS function?
The method is divided into three main stages:
Capture: CO₂ is divided from other gases on the emission supply.
Transport: The captured fuel is compressed and moved through pipelines or ships.
Storage: CO₂ is injected into deep underground rock formations, such as depleted oil fields or saline aquifers.
Which industries profit by far the most from CCS?
CCS is very successful in sectors which have been difficult to decarbonise, which includes:
Cement production
Steel production
Chemical processing
Normal fuel and coal electrical power vegetation
What are some great here benefits of CCS?
Sizeable emission reductions in superior-output sectors
Integration with present infrastructure
Supports the production of lower-carbon hydrogen
Can complement renewable Power through intermittency
What exactly are the limitations of CCS?
Higher costs for set up and upkeep
Power-intense seize and storage course of action
Calls for cautious web page checking to forestall leaks
Is CCS a substitution for renewable Electrical power?
No, CCS is Carbon not really a substitute for renewables. It’s a complementary engineering that can perform together with wind, solar, and various clean energy answers to lessen overall emissions.
Can CCS aid accomplish world wide local climate aims?
Of course. When coupled with other technologies like renewables and hydrogen, CCS can Participate in a significant part in lowering world-wide emissions and meeting very long-term local climate targets.
